>Description:
While http://www.freebsd.org/cgi/man.cgi already knows about FreeBSD's 5.2
release, the entry for -current is still called `5.1-current' and should be
changed to `5.2-current'.  The same update should happen for `5.1-RELEASE and
Ports' too, I guess.
